Output 38e722a82b65b23c0cb99671450505a91a84701fa7de44cc80869ca43edad706:18

value
2915463
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ba3c549e9fcf1f30232e0e1253bdbc8e8c02785f OP_EQUALVERIFY OP_CHECKSIG
address
1HyixXB6Kfzzdd4hWg9CVBKi6XaM18PFtL
transaction
38e722a82b65b23c0cb99671450505a91a84701fa7de44cc80869ca43edad706
confirmations
542033
spent
true